A new round of competition for the attention of Moscow dial-up subscribers was marked by a marketing action by the Moscow broadband leader
COMSTAR-Direct (Stream brand). The operator suggested “retrogrades” to exchange their old modems for new ones - ADSLs. According
to the company, these ADSL-modems users receive as a gift.
The minimum unlimited tariff "Stream" should also attract dial-upers. The PRIME plan requires a monthly payment of $ 8 - this is an unprecedented offer on the Russian broadband market. The speed threshold for the tariff - 128 kbps. The action itself with the exchange of modems will last from March 14 to May 14.
J'son & Partners experts believe that Stream's marketing will bring results in the form of an increase in the subscriber base growth rate of the operator, as well as increased price competition in the market as a whole. According to their estimates, Stream is able to increase the rate of connection of new users by one and a half times,
Kommersant reports. For the operator, we recall, this is more than relevant, since in the second half of 2006 it significantly
lost to competitors in terms of growth - it increased only 20% of the base, whereas AKADO and Corbina had 75 and 100% growth, respectively.

One way or another, the Stream price offer is two times cheaper than the average in Moscow. According to MDM Bank analyst Elena Bazhenova, the operator tries to maintain its market share with this dumping. “In the current situation on the market, its actions may provoke a price war - other Internet providers may donate financial indicators, reducing tariffs in order not to miss new connections,” she said.
